Long-standing diabetes is often complicated by retinopathy. The mechanisms that induce the development of diabetic retinopathy are incompletely understood and include alterations in bone marrow derived vasculogenic cells called "endothelial progenitor cells".
Fenofibrate is a PPAR-alpha agonist used for the treatment of mixed dislipidemia and hypertriglyceridemia. In addition to lowering triglyceride-rich lipoproteins, PPAR-alpha agonism with fenofibrate has several additional molecular benefit on the vessel wall, such as reduction of inflammation. In a trial conducted in type 2 diabetic patients, the drug fenofibrate has reduced retinopathy-related endpoints suggesting a direct effect of the drug on the mechanisms that drive the development of this complication.
Preliminary data of ours on the effects of fenofibrate on cultured EPC show that this drug has the potential to improve EPC and, consequently, may benefit patients with retinopathy.
Herein, the investigators hypothesize that fenofibrate treatment can increase circulating EPC levels in diabetic patients with retinopathy, compared to placebo.
